Re: problems installing 2.4 kernel (2)



Irvine Russell wrote:
> Thanks to nate and jerome.
>
> I followed your suggestions and have
> another problem.
>
> When I:
>
>   apt-get install kernel-image-2.4.9-386
>
> I get the following (I haven't include
> the whole text)
>
>   Sorry but the following packages have unmet
> dependencies:
>
>   kernel-image-2.4.9-386: Depends : initrd-tools
> (0>=0.1.6) but it is not going to be installed
>   E:Sorry, broken packages

You need to install initrd-tools. If your sources.list still includes
"deb http://people.debian.org/~bunk/debian potato main", "apt-get
install initrd-tools" should install initrd-tools-1.1.11

>
> I searched around the list a little and found
> someone with a similar problem who was told to
> create a file /etc/kernel-img.conf and add the
> line
>
>   do_initrd = Yes

I think doing this only suppresses a warning message about the kernel
being an initrd kernel when you try to install it. I don't have it in my /etc/kernel-img.

I use lilo to boot. To get kernel-image-2.4.9 to boot, I need to put the following in my lilo.conf:

image=/vmlinuz-2.4.9-386
	label=linux-2.4.9-386
	read-only
        initrd=/boot/initrd-2.4.9-386

I'm not sure what you need to do if you use grub.
